'08 RAPs: Oakland Athletics

"Money-balling" GM Billy Beane was in full sell mode this off-season. He traded away both his best pitcher (Dan Haren) and posittion player (Nick Swisher) after realizing that his team has no chance of winning.
Here's the list of Beane's moves:
-Traded pitchers Dan Haren and Connor Robertson to the Oakland Athletics for pitchers Brett Anderson, Dana Eveland and Greg Smith, outfielders Aaron Cunningham and Carlos Gonzalez and infielder Chris Carter.
-Acquired outfielder Ryan Sweeney and pitchers Gio Gonzalez and Fautino De Los Santos from the Chicago White Sox for outfielder Nick Swisher.
-Signed outfielder Emil Brown to a one-year contract.
-Signed first baseman Mike Sweeney to a minor league contract.
-Signed catcher Matt LeCroy to a minor league contract
